Change isn’t always comfortable, but it’s often the clearest signal that growth is happening. After many years in real estate, I’ve learned that the real risk isn’t changing. It’s staying the same when your business has already evolved. That lesson is what led us to make an important strategic decision, and it’s one I think many agents can learn from.

Why did we make this change? This year, we made a deliberate shift by changing our website from Boulder Home Source to Colorado Home Source. When you build brand recognition over time, changing a name is never a casual decision. Agents have asked why we would move away from a name that had trust, history, and strong SEO behind it. The answer comes down to alignment between brand and reality.

How it all started. When my wife and I first launched Boulder Home Source, we were working out of a small office in Boulder with no plans to expand beyond Boulder County. Our business was hyper-local by design. In 1998, being early to online real estate gave us an advantage, and from the start, we focused on building an asset that would last.

Over the years, we invested more than $1,000,000 into SEO, paid search, and marketing. The goal was never quick wins. The goal was to build authority, visibility, and long-term lead flow that supported consistent growth.

Growth beyond Boulder. As demand increased, our reach expanded. Today, our team includes more than 22 experienced brokers and agents serving buyers and sellers from Castle Rock to Fort Collins. At that point, the name Boulder Home Source no longer reflected the full scope of our service area or the people we serve. The name had become limiting, even though our expertise and coverage had grown significantly. Continuing under the old name no longer matched who we are today.

“Our service standards, market knowledge, and client-first approach remain unchanged.”

Why does Colorado Home Source fit? After thoughtful conversations with our SEO experts and our internal team, it became clear that a change was necessary. Colorado Home Source gives us the flexibility to build, scale, and improve the website in ways that support both our current reach and where we’re headed next.

While the name has changed, our foundation hasn’t. Our office is still based in Boulder, which will always be home. Our service standards, market knowledge, and client-first approach remain unchanged.

What does this mean for you? If you’re a real estate agent, the lesson is clear. As your business grows, your branding, positioning, and platforms must evolve with it. A name, website, or niche that once fit perfectly can quietly start holding you back if it no longer reflects your reach or direction.

Growth requires adjustment, and thoughtful change creates opportunity. This transition wasn’t about rebranding for appearance. It was about aligning our platform with scale, clarity, and long-term business strategy.
